    Visual consumption, collective memory and the representation of war

    Conceiving of the visual as a significant force in the production and dissemination of collective memory, we argue that a new genre of World War Two films has recently emerged that form part of a new discursive “regime of memory” about the war and those that fought and lived through it, constituting a commemoration as much about reflecting on the present as it is about remembering the past. First, we argue that these films seek to reaffirm a (particular conception of a) US national identity and military patriotism in the post–Cold War era by importing World War Two as the key meta‐narrative of America’s relationship to war in order to “correct” and help “erase” Vietnam’s more negative discursive rendering. Second, we argue that these films attempt to rewrite the history of World War Two by elevating and illuminating the role of the US at the expense of the Allies, further serving to reaffirm America’s position of political and military dominance in the current age, and third, that these films form part of a celebration of the generation that fought World War Two, which may accord them a position of nostalgic and sentimental greatness, as their collective spirit and notions of duty and service shine against the foil of what might frequently be seen as our own present moral ambivalence

    Hierarchical brain networks active in approach and avoidance goal pursuit

    Effective approach/avoidance goal pursuit is critical for attaining long-term health and well-being. Research on the neural correlates of key goal pursuit processes (e.g., motivation) has long been of interest, with lateralization in prefrontal cortex being a particularly fruitful target of investigation. However, this literature has often been limited by a lack of spatial specificity and has not delineated the precise aspects of approach/avoidance motivation involved. Additionally, the relationships among brain regions (i.e., network connectivity) vital to goal pursuit remain largely unexplored. Specificity in location, process, and network relationship is vital for moving beyond gross characterizations of function and identifying the precise cortical mechanisms involved in motivation. The present paper integrates research using more spatially specific methodologies (e.g., functional magnetic resonance imaging) with the rich psychological literature on approach/avoidance to propose an integrative network model that takes advantage of the strengths of each of these literatures

    Cortical organization of inhibition-related functions and modulation by psychopathology

    Individual differences in inhibition-related functions have been implicated as risk factors for a broad range of psychopathology, including anxiety and depression. Delineating neural mechanisms of distinct inhibition-related functions may clarify their role in the development and maintenance of psychopathology. The present study tested the hypothesis that activity in common and distinct brain regions would be associated with an ecologically sensitive, self-report measure of inhibition and a laboratory performance measure of prepotent response inhibition. Results indicated that sub-regions of DLPFC distinguished measures of inhibition, whereas left inferior frontal gyrus and bilateral inferior parietal cortex were associated with both types of inhibition. Additionally, co-occurring anxiety and depression modulated neural activity in select brain regions associated with response inhibition. Results imply that specific combinations of anxiety and depression dimensions are associated with failure to implement top-down attentional control as reflected in inefficient recruitment of posterior DLPFC and increased activation in regions associated with threat (MTG) and worry (BA10). Present findings elucidate possible neural mechanisms of interference that could help explain executive control deficits in psychopathology
